SLM metal 3D printing


Metal 3D printing using the SLM process (selective laser melting) is one of the most sophisticated additive manufacturing processes. To ensure that components meet the high requirements, it is crucial to set the right course as early as the design phase. Only in this way can geometries, material properties and post-processing be optimally coordinated. Complete solutions instead of individual deliveries


A common pain point in procurement is that many suppliers only make small contributions to the finished component or assembly. Coordinating these parts means that components have to pass through many different hands, which can affect time and quality. HDC Blueprints takes this effort off your hands. We combine our own design and manufacturing capabilities with a strong, local partner network and deliver complete assemblies on request. This includes 3D printed parts as well as CNC milled parts, sheet metal parts or standard parts. These are reworked, assembled, tested and painted by us on request. This means you receive a ready-to-use solution from a single source. We pay particular attention to production within Germany.

How long does it take to construct a project?

Answer

The duration depends on the complexity and scope. A simple component can be created within a few minutes or hours, while larger and more complex designs can take several weeks or even months. After an initial analysis and definition of the requirements, we will let you know the estimated time frame - free of charge.
